The banners (ads) in 12.04's Software Center are buggy. At this moment
there are 4 banners in the SC. The second banner should be the
Multiwinia banner and direct to the Multiwinia game.

It works like that on my Eee-Pc. But on my desktop the second banner is
the Tickr banner and when I click it, it directs me to Multiwinia. On my
desktop the Tickr banner shows twice, where it should only show once.

I find it difficult to explain, so I made a video;
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=F1PfqvnGagc

Also the Definitive Guides of Ubuntu has a complete black background on
my Eee-Pc, while on my desktop the background is 50% black and 50%
white. I believe the background was intended to be black?

I am using an 1920x1080 resolution flatscreen.
